Unconditioned Stimulus
In classical conditioning, a stimulus that naturally and automatically triggers an unconditioned response without prior learning.
Discriminative Stimulus
A cue or signal in the environment that indicates that a specific behavior will result in a particular consequence.
Unconditioned Stimulus
A stimulus that naturally and automatically triggers a response without any need for learning.
Primary Reinforcer
An innately reinforcing stimulus, such as one that satisfies a biological need.
